The Aero Club
Type: Bar

Airplane-and-neon-beer-sign décor aside, this dive bar has a big local following and a number of regulars are here at any given time. There is a gigantic wall of liquors including over 800 whiskeys (yes, you read that right) and 100 vodkas. There are also 20 beers on tap and another 20 or so in bottles. Beyond the booze, you'll find two pool tables, a jukebox, fantastic and friendly staff, and a great mix of people hanging out and having fun. Opened originally in 1947, Aero Club has gone through ownership changes and upgrades, but it's still a well-loved local institution.
